Is CTC the same as in-hand salary?
No. CTC is the total annual cost to company. In-hand salary is what you receive after employee PF, tax/TDS, professional tax, and other deductions.
Does this calculate exact payroll?
No. It estimates take-home salary from common India salary assumptions. Your exact payroll can differ based on employer policy, state, reimbursements, exemptions, bonus rules, and tax declarations.
Which tax regime does the auto TDS option use?
The auto TDS option uses the Indian new tax regime slab structure for FY 2025-26 with standard deduction and rebate assumptions for salaried income.
